    Adult trip,7th anniversary Apr to Poly. ADRs @ Jiko, Monsieur P, Citricos, Boathouse, S of A. Never been to any of these but I keep checking in hopes for V&A 2 come open- no luck. What exp. do you recommend? We've only be @ Xmas time w/kids

    Hello Marsha!

    Congratulations! Adult trips are an incredible way to experience the magic of Walt Disney World Resort in a whole new way. I love our family vacations, but every once in awhile it's nice to spend some Fairy Tale time with just my Prince Charming. We've celebrated several anniversaries at the Most Magical Place On Earth.

    You definitely have a difficult and delicious decision to make as all of those choices are wonderful. Personally, I would choose Jiko or Citricos, but really, I recommend checking out the menus of each and seeing which appeals more to your tastes. The ambiance in all of them will set the mood perfectly for your Storybook occasion. If reservations are available at either California Grill or Narcoossee's, I recommend them as well. Not only do these two locations offer divine dining options, but they also boast beautiful views of Magic Kingdom's Wishes nighttime spectacular adding a bit of Pixie Dust to your Happily Ever After celebration.

    Make sure to also keep an eye on Victoria & Albert's. As your vacation draws closer you may just see the reservation you want open up. Congratulations again and please let us know if there is anything else we are able to assist you with.
